Private LTE CAT-M1 IoT Node — Build a Battery-Powered Cellular Sensor Station with SIM7080G & Arduino Nano

Every part needed, pre-tested for compatibility, with an AI build companion trained on this exact project. Shipped from Bengaluru in 3-5 days.

Difficulty: Advanced Build Time: 6-8 hours Age: 18-21 Skill: Cellular IoT and low-power firmware design

Deploy a standalone sensor node that reports temperature, humidity, pressure, and timestamped data over private LTE CAT-M1 — without WiFi, without gateways. This kit equips you with a SIM7080G module, Arduino Nano, and precision sensors to create a field-ready logger that sleeps for years on a single coin cell using PSM. Perfect for remote agriculture monitoring, industrial asset tracking, or Smart India Hackathon challenges requiring long-life cellular connectivity.

What You'll Build

You'll assemble and program a weatherproof IoT node that wakes up periodically, reads DHT22 and BMP280 environmental data, logs it to microSD with an RTC timestamp, displays status on an OLED, and transmits everything over LTE CAT-M1 using ultra-low-power PSM mode. The firmware optimises battery drain so the node can run unattended for months on the included LiPo, mimicking a 2-year coin cell deployment once fine-tuned.

What You'll Learn

  • Configure and drive the SIM7080G CAT-M1 module from Arduino using AT commands and TinyGSM library
  • Implement Power Saving Mode (PSM) to reduce cellular modem current draw to microamps between transmissions
  • Interface multiple I2C sensors (DHT22, BMP280, DS3231) on a shared bus and log to SD card with FAT32
  • Design a bare-metal soldered assembly on protoboard and encapsulate it in an IP65 enclosure for field deployment
